The technical specifications provided are equally impressive for professional workflows. Receiving a 4500×5400 pixel PNG file at 300 dpi ensures that whether you are printing large-scale banners or small stickers, the quality remains sharp. The inclusion of EPS and SVG files means that vector editing is possible, allowing designers to adjust colors to match specific brand palettes or resize elements for different applications. This level of control is essential for maintaining visual consistency across all touchpoints, from web design headers to physical merchandise.

Critical Considerations and Designer Notes
While the asset is robust, there are areas where caution is advised. It should be used carefully in formal corporate branding contexts where a more conservative aesthetic is required. The playful and organic nature of the design might clash with dense information layouts or highly structured financial reports. Similarly, avoid using it in small mobile graphics where intricate details might get lost, or on low-contrast backgrounds where the visual impact could diminish.
If your brand relies on an overly minimal style, ensure that this clipart does not compete with your main message. It should complement, not overpower. In text-heavy ads, the graphic might distract from the copy if not balanced correctly. Always test the design with your specific brand color palette to ensure harmony. Check how it looks in black and white usage, as many print materials require grayscale versions. Place it inside real campaign mockups to see how it interacts with other elements, and preview it on mobile screens to verify readability.
Font pairing is another critical step. Compare the graphic against serif fonts for a classic feel, sans-serif for a modern look, or script and handwritten styles for a personal touch. Review spacing and balance meticulously to avoid clutter. Finally, always confirm the commercial licensing before using it in paid campaigns, client work, or business branding. Understanding the terms of the commercial license protects your business and ensures you can leverage these design assets fully.
